中文字幕免费精品_亚洲视频自拍_亚洲综合国产激情另类一区_色综合咪咪久久

ADO.NET制做一個登錄案例
來源:易賢網 閱讀:1256 次 日期:2016-08-05 14:41:09
溫馨提示:易賢網小編為您整理了“ADO.NET制做一個登錄案例”,方便廣大網友查閱!

這篇文章主要為大家介紹了ADO.NET制做一個登錄案例的詳細過程,具有一定的參考價值,感興趣的小伙伴們可以參考一下

總體思路.根據用戶輸入的用戶名和密碼,來判斷,和數據庫里面存的是不是一樣,如果一樣就表明登錄成功,否則就登錄失敗。

方案一:

1.select* from 表名 where username="用戶輸入的用戶名" 

2.如果存在 reader.Read(),即用戶名存在,接著就判斷用戶輸入的密碼,和取到的密碼(reader.GetString(reader.GetOridinal("密碼字段")))是不是一樣,如果一樣就登錄成功,否則就登錄失敗。

方案二: 

select * from 表名 where username="用戶輸入的用戶名" and password="用戶輸入的密碼",如果查得到數據,就登錄成功。否則登錄失敗。 

下面,我們來使用方案一,來做一個登錄的案例吧。

這里,為了方便,還是用控制臺應用程序吧。

前奏:

我這次要把連接字符串寫在配置文件中, 

1.首先我們要添加命名空間的引用:System.Configuration; 

2.然后在我們的配置文件AppConfig中,的<Configuration>節點下面添加連接字符串的相關節點信息。 

<configuration>

<span style="color: #800000"><connectionStrings>

 <add name="ConStr" connectionString="server=.;database=DB_USERS;uid=sa;pwd=Pasword_1"/>

 </connectionStrings>

</span> <startup> 

<supportedRuntime version="v4.0" sku=".NETFramework,Version=v4.5" />

 </startup>

</configuration>

標紅顏色的地方,就是我們添加的連接字符串節點信息; 

3.然后我習慣,創建一個DBHelper類,在里面聲明一個方法來獲取,連接字符串:

using System;

using System.Collections.Generic;

using System.Linq;

using System.Text;

using System.Threading.Tasks;

using System.Configuration;//在項目中添加這個的引用,并在這個類里面添加這個命名空間

namespace ADO.NET登錄案例1

{

  public class DBHelper

  {

    public static string GetConnectionStrings()

    {

      //使用ConfigurationManager類,來獲取連接字符串的信息。

      return ConfigurationManager.ConnectionStrings["ConStr"].ConnectionString;

    }

  }

}

4.這次我依然使用存儲過程,創建一個根據用戶名查詢的存儲過程:

IF OBJECT_ID('Ins_User','P') IS NOT NULL 

 DROP PROCEDURE Ins_User

 GO

 CREATE PROCEDURE Ins_User

 @name NVARCHAR(20)

 AS 

 SELECT * FROM dbo.T_USERS WHERE T_NAME=@name

 GO 

存儲過程

前期的準備工作,做好之后,現在我們來開始寫程序,編碼實現:

思路:方案一,說了,首先我們當然是讓用戶輸入,用戶名和密碼,然后根據用戶輸入的用戶名來查詢數據庫對應的表中,有沒有相關數據,如果沒有的話,就提示用戶名不存在,有的話,就繼續判斷用戶輸入的密碼是否正確(拿用戶輸入的密碼和數據庫對應的密碼,進行判斷),如果正確,就提示登錄成功,否則就提示密碼錯誤。 

*這里我使用參數化查詢,來寫登錄的案例,目的是為了防止SQL注入攻擊。

using System;

using System.Collections.Generic;

using System.Linq;

using System.Text;

using System.Threading.Tasks;

using System.Data;

using System.Data.SqlClient;

namespace ADO.NET登錄案例1

{

  class Program

  {

    static void Main(string[] args)

    {

      //提示用戶輸入用戶名

      Console.WriteLine("請輸入用戶名:");

      //使用Console.ReadLine()接收用戶輸入的信息

      string userName = Console.ReadLine();

      //提示用戶輸入密碼

      Console.WriteLine("請輸入密碼:");

      string password = Console.ReadLine();

      //現在就是開始使用ADO.NET技術,來查詢數據庫了

      //連接方式訪問

      //1.創建連接對象(連接字符串)

      SqlConnection scon = new SqlConnection(DBHelper.GetConnectionStrings());

      //2.創建命令對象(并為命令對象設置屬性值)

      SqlCommand scmd = new SqlCommand();

      scmd.CommandText = "Ins_User";

      scmd.CommandType = CommandType.StoredProcedure;

      scmd.Connection = scon;

      //3打開連接

      scon.Open();

      //設置參數

      scmd.Parameters.Add(new SqlParameter("@name",userName.Trim()));

      //4.執行命令

      SqlDataReader reader = scmd.ExecuteReader(CommandBehavior.CloseConnection);

      //5處理數據

      if (reader.Read())

      {

        if (password.Trim().ToString() == reader["T_PWD"].ToString())

        {

          Console.WriteLine("登錄成功");

        }

        else

        {

          Console.WriteLine("密碼錯誤");

        }

      }

      else

      {

        Console.WriteLine("用戶名不存在");

      }

      //讀取器用完一定要關閉

      reader.Dispose();

      Console.ReadKey();

    }

  }

}

以上就是本文的全部內容,希望對大家的學習有所幫助

更多信息請查看網絡編程
易賢網手機網站地址:ADO.NET制做一個登錄案例
由于各方面情況的不斷調整與變化,易賢網提供的所有考試信息和咨詢回復僅供參考,敬請考生以權威部門公布的正式信息和咨詢為準!

2026上岸·考公考編培訓報班

  • 報班類型
  • 姓名
  • 手機號
  • 驗證碼
關于我們 | 聯系我們 | 人才招聘 | 網站聲明 | 網站幫助 | 非正式的簡要咨詢 | 簡要咨詢須知 | 新媒體/短視頻平臺 | 手機站點 | 投訴建議
工業和信息化部備案號:滇ICP備2023014141號-1 云南省教育廳備案號:云教ICP備0901021 滇公網安備53010202001879號 人力資源服務許可證:(云)人服證字(2023)第0102001523號
云南網警備案專用圖標
聯系電話:0871-65099533/13759567129 獲取招聘考試信息及咨詢關注公眾號:hfpxwx
咨詢QQ:1093837350(9:00—18:00)版權所有:易賢網
云南網警報警專用圖標
中文字幕免费精品_亚洲视频自拍_亚洲综合国产激情另类一区_色综合咪咪久久
欧美日韩国产在线一区| 一本在线高清不卡dvd| 国产一区二区三区免费不卡 | 国产视频在线观看一区二区三区 | 久久精品国产99国产精品| 欧美日韩中文字幕日韩欧美| 欧美日韩在线亚洲一区蜜芽| 国产日本欧美在线观看| 在线视频欧美一区| 国产精品乱码妇女bbbb| 亚洲女女女同性video| 国产精品剧情在线亚洲| 久久gogo国模啪啪人体图| 狠狠色丁香婷综合久久| 欧美mv日韩mv国产网站app| 伊人夜夜躁av伊人久久| 欧美福利视频| 欧美一级午夜免费电影| 亚洲国产高清一区二区三区| 欧美91视频| 亚洲一区999| 亚洲高清中文字幕| 欧美精品久久一区| 亚洲天堂免费观看| 激情久久五月| 欧美午夜精品久久久久久人妖| 欧美一区二区精品| 一本久久a久久精品亚洲| 欧美香蕉视频| 牛牛精品成人免费视频| 欧美一级久久| 亚洲欧美99| 久久aⅴ国产欧美74aaa| 亚洲精品在线观看免费| 韩国av一区二区三区| 国产综合在线视频| 国内精品久久久久伊人av| 欧美天堂亚洲电影院在线观看 | 日韩视频中午一区| 亚洲国产日韩欧美综合久久| 国产精品―色哟哟| 国产精品爱啪在线线免费观看| 老鸭窝亚洲一区二区三区| 亚洲视频在线观看网站| 99视频国产精品免费观看| 9国产精品视频| 夜夜嗨av一区二区三区网站四季av| 日韩一级成人av| 亚洲一区二区影院| 欧美一区二区三区精品电影| 欧美一区二区三区免费视| 久久久久久久久岛国免费| 久久综合伊人77777| 久久香蕉国产线看观看av| 欧美在线观看视频在线| 久久久99国产精品免费| 欧美日韩亚洲一区三区| 国产亚洲成人一区| 亚洲精品国久久99热| 性亚洲最疯狂xxxx高清| 久久婷婷丁香| 欧美午夜性色大片在线观看| 国产一区二区三区久久悠悠色av | 欧美成人综合| 欧美日韩福利| 国产一区二区三区av电影| 一区二区三区在线不卡| 亚洲图色在线| 欧美日韩亚洲综合一区| 亚洲国产精品专区久久| 久久精品二区| 国产自产在线视频一区| 在线观看视频一区二区| 欧美亚洲一区二区在线| 欧美区二区三区| 亚洲成色最大综合在线| 久久久天天操| 精品成人久久| 久久国产精品一区二区| 国产小视频国产精品| 久久久www成人免费毛片麻豆| 国产精品尤物| 久久色在线观看| 国内外成人免费激情在线视频网站 | 国产欧美在线| 久久综合精品一区| 亚洲国产精品精华液网站| 欧美日韩精品福利| 亚洲精品视频免费观看| 午夜在线精品偷拍| 在线观看一区二区视频| 欧美大片一区二区三区| 尤物精品在线| 国产精品卡一卡二卡三| 免费在线观看日韩欧美| 在线精品高清中文字幕| 欧美成人午夜激情在线| 亚洲免费视频网站| 国产欧美精品xxxx另类| 亚洲欧美一区在线| 国产精品美女久久久久aⅴ国产馆| 经典三级久久| 麻豆成人在线| 欧美亚洲专区| av成人国产| 亚洲黄色在线| 国产日韩欧美中文| 欧美亚洲第一区| 欧美成人tv| 久久精品综合一区| 午夜精品一区二区三区四区| 在线欧美不卡| 在线日韩成人| 欧美视频四区| 欧美日韩天堂| 欧美日韩在线三区| 欧美视频在线观看一区| 美女视频网站黄色亚洲| 久久久久久久999精品视频| 亚洲一区二区三区视频播放| 激情六月婷婷久久| 亚洲精品乱码久久久久久黑人| 蜜臀a∨国产成人精品| 日韩西西人体444www| 国产免费成人在线视频| 欧美专区日韩专区| 亚洲福利视频免费观看| 国模精品一区二区三区色天香| 欧美久久久久久久久| 亚洲欧美日韩第一区 | 欧美成人一区在线| 亚洲欧美日韩在线不卡| 午夜精品久久久久久久久久久| 亚洲成人在线视频网站| 国产欧美亚洲视频| 国产精品草莓在线免费观看| 欧美91福利在线观看| 久久综合久色欧美综合狠狠| 午夜欧美电影在线观看| 翔田千里一区二区| 亚洲欧美日韩国产一区| 久久精品在线| 欧美成人午夜| 欧美日韩大片| 国产日韩精品久久久| 国产喷白浆一区二区三区| 激情久久综艺| 欧美日韩精品免费| 欧美日韩精品一区二区| 国产精品午夜电影| 亚洲风情在线资源站| 一本色道久久综合一区| 欧美一区二区三区精品电影| 午夜精品剧场| 美日韩精品免费| 国产精品v欧美精品∨日韩| 欧美性做爰毛片| 亚洲国产欧美日韩另类综合| 亚洲乱码视频| 欧美自拍偷拍午夜视频| 欧美韩日亚洲| 国产一区二区三区久久精品| 亚洲国产一成人久久精品| 一区二区三区高清不卡| 欧美日韩第一区| 亚洲精品韩国| 久久综合九色综合网站| 欧美日韩国产区一| 国产欧美在线| 亚洲视频欧美视频| 麻豆成人综合网| 狠狠干狠狠久久| 亚洲免费在线看| 国产精品国产自产拍高清av| 亚洲精品美女久久久久| 你懂的视频欧美| 精品动漫3d一区二区三区免费版| 久久久精品tv| 狠狠色综合日日| 免费看成人av| 国内精品国语自产拍在线观看| 亚洲一区二区在| 国产一二精品视频| 久久久人成影片一区二区三区| 国产精品久久久免费| 午夜久久久久久| 韩国一区二区三区美女美女秀| 久久蜜桃资源一区二区老牛| 在线日韩视频| 欧美激情亚洲一区| 亚洲网站在线| 国产一区二区三区直播精品电影| 欧美在线视频免费| 国产一区在线看| 欧美专区中文字幕| 亚洲日韩欧美一区二区在线| 欧美激情精品久久久久久免费印度| 在线播放日韩| 国产精品久久久久久久第一福利| 亚洲欧美国产一区二区三区|